
Рекомендуется рассмотреть использование технологий, позволяющих создавать интерактивные интерфейсы с высокой производительностью. Тщательный анализ существующих методов разработки демонстрирует, что подходы, основанные на современной среде, способны обеспечить качественный пользовательский опыт. Применение аналогичных инструментов предоставляет возможность доступа к мощным функциональным возможностям мобильных устройств.
При выборе инструментов для разработки обращайте внимание на поддержку графики и multimedia. Легкость интеграции с другими сервисами и библиотеками также играет решающую роль в создании успешных цифровых решений. Плавность работы и высокая отзывчивость интерфейса – это основные факторы, на которые стоит ориентироваться при разработке.
Подумайте о возможностях кроссплатформенной разработки. Это позволит расширить аудиторию и сделать продукт более доступным. Использование подходов, поддерживающих взаимодействие с различными устройствами, ускоряет процесс сборки и тестирования, что в конечном итоге приведет к более качественному результату.
Интеграция Silverlight в мобильные веб-приложения на iPhone
Для успешного встраивания Silverlight в веб-решения мобильного устройства необходимо учитывать несколько аспектов. Начните с выбора подходящего браузера, поддерживающего выполнение Silverlight. Safari ограничивает эту функциональность, поэтому рассмотрите альтернативы, такие как браузеры с расширенной поддержкой плагинов.
Следующим шагом является применение технологии глубоких ссылок. Это позволит пользователям напрямую открывать определенные функции приложения, улучшая навигацию и пользовательский опыт. Интеграция с средствами навигации поможет сохранять контекст между сессиями.
Оптимизация интерфейса под размеры экранов мобильных устройств обеспечивает удобство использования. Разработайте адаптивный пользовательский интерфейс, который будет корректно отображаться на всех разрешениях экрана, сообщили данные о пользовательской активности.
Не забывайте о производительности. Используйте легкие визуальные элементы и минимизируйте количество запросов к серверу. Это поможет избежать задержек при загрузке и сделает доступ к контенту более быстрым.
Для улучшения взаимодействия с пользователем используйте касания для управления элементами. Элементы управления должны быть интуитивными и отзывчивыми, облегчая выполнение как простых, так и сложных действий.
Обратите внимание на кроссплатформенные аспекты. Мобильные решения должны обеспечивать согласованность функционала на различных устройствах и операционных системах, что позволит расширить аудиторию пользователей и повысить универсальность вашего продукта.
Тестирование на реальных устройствах имеет решающее значение. Эмулирование не всегда дает точное представление о работе приложения, поэтому проводите тестирование на дымящих устройствах для выявления всех возможных проблем.
Использование аналитики также является важным элементом. Интегрируйте инструменты для отслеживания пользовательских действий, чтобы собирать данные и вносить корректировки, улучшая функционал и повышая удовлетворенность пользователей.
Преимущества и ограничения использования Silverlight на iOS устройствах
Высокая производительность графики и анимаций обеспечивается благодаря оптимизированному движку. Приложения могут использовать богатый интерфейс, что позволяет создавать интерактивные элементы с плавными переходами. Наличие поддержки мультимедиа повышает возможности разработки, позволяя внедрять видео и аудио без дополнительных плагинов.
Интеграция с серверными технологиями упрощает взаимодействие и обмен данными, что делает разработку более быстрой и удобной. Мощные инструменты отладки и профилирования помогают выявлять узкие места и устранять ошибки на ранних стадиях.
Среди ограничений стоит отметить отсутствие нативной поддержки. Это может вызывать задержки в загрузке содержимого и не всегда обеспечивает стабильную работу. Поддержка актуальных стандартов и обновлений также может оставлять желать лучшего, что ограничивает использование новых возможностей, доступных в других технологиях.
Необходимость в установке стороннего плагина создает сложности для пользователей, которые могут просто отказаться от использования из-за дополнительных шагов. Сложность адаптации приложений для различных устройств увеличивает время разработки и тестирования. Без полноценной поддержки на мобильных устройствах и отсутствия крупных обновлений, разработка может оказаться менее привлекательной в долгосрочной перспективе.
Примеры успешных приложений на Silverlight для iPhone
Приложение для потоковой передачи видео, где пользователи могут легко делиться и просматривать контент. Интерфейс предлагает удобные функции поиска и сортировки, что способствует положительному пользовательскому опыту.
Система для управления задачами, позволяющая пользователям планировать и отслеживать прогресс. Она включает в себя напоминания и аналитические инструменты, что делает ее незаменимой для повышения продуктивности.
Мобильная версия популярной игры с интуитивно понятным интерфейсом и элементами коллекционирования. Пользователи отмечают разнообразие уровней и возможности взаимодействия с друзьями, что стимулирует долгосрочное использование.
Приложение для создания заметок, которое синхронизирует данные между устройствами. Оно обеспечивает возможность добавления мультимедийных материалов и обмена записями с другими пользователями, что расширяет функциональность.
Платформа для обучения, предлагающая интерактивные курсы и видеоуроки. Интуитивно понятный интерфейс и система оценок создают благоприятные условия для повышения квалификации пользователей.
Специализированный клиент для работы с социальными сетями, предлагающий уникальные функции для улучшения взаимодействия с контентом. Использование графиков и аналитических инструментов помогает пользователям лучше понимать свои предпочтения.
